Facebook tends to resize videos because most of their users tend to use "cell phones" when on the site. It's just a different type of audience between Facebook and Youtube. But on their community page asking the same question I found this under the "recommended" settings from the user, but not exactly the site.

"1. H.264 video with AAC audio in MOV or MP4 format
2. An aspect ratio no larger than 1280px wide and divisible by 16px
3. A frame rate at, or below, 30fps
4. Stereo audio with a sample rate of 44,100hz"
